Rangers have confirmed the signing of striker Alfredo Morelos from HJK Helsinki on a three-year contract.

The Colombian U20 international flew into Scotland for talks last week ahead of a potential move and the club have confirmed that the deal has now been completed.

Morelos started his career at Independiente Medellín in his home country before an initial loan move to HJK last year turned into a permanent switch.

He had scored 11 goals in nine appearances this season to help the Finnish side to the top of the league before his move to Glasgow.

The 20-year old is Pedro Caixinha's sixth signing of the summer, joining Ryan Jack, Bruno Alves, Fabio Cardoso, Daniel Candeias and Dalcio at Ibrox.

Mexican pair Carlos Pena and Eduardo Herrera have also recently been in Glasgow for talks ahead of proposed moves to Rangers, with both needing to secure work permits before the deals are completed.
